Trosolwg o'r swydd

An opportunity has arisen for a  full-time Band 6 Speech  and Language Therapist to join a highly experienced,  multi-professional team working with people with learning disabilities in Tameside.

The post-holder will be based within the Community Learning Disability Team at Hollingworth Clinic in Tameside .  We deliver high quality healthcare  assessments and interventions to people with complex and challenging needs. The team comprises of community nurses,   physiotherapists, speech and language therapists, occupational therapist, psychologists,  assistant practitioners and psychiatry input. 

Prif ddyletswyddau'r swydd

Delivery of evidence based Speech and Language Therapy assessments and interventions to adults with learning disabilities who may have complex and challenging needs. You will be working in a multi-disciplinary context with the expectation to be person centred, creative and innovative in meeting the communication needs of individuals whilst offering support to families and carers. The postholder will be an excellent team player who demonstrates the ability to work effectively and productively.

 

Key Responsibilities of the Post:

To undertake, highly complex swallowing (once qualified) and communication assessments in order to diagnose speech, language, communication and swallowing disorders.

To develop hypotheses based on assessment and implement Specialist Speech & Language Therapy treatment and programmes of care and discharge appropriately.

To use evidence based practice to inform clinical decision making in relation to communication impairments and dysphagia.
